Hill Top emerges from the heathland as a quiet gathering of homes where the horizon feels perpetually wide and untamed. It lies 5.5 miles south-south-west of Southampton (from Southampton: bearing 193°T, OS grid SU 401 032), and is situated north-east of Beaulieu village. Residents here live amidst the ancient, sweeping expanse of the New Forest National Park, where the light often catches the damp heather in shades of bruised copper. The land is marked by the deep silence of history, evidenced by the nearby Well House, a scheduled monument that holds its secrets beneath a shroud of moss and tangled bramble. To the east, the earth rises in subtle, prehistoric swells where two bowl barrows lie, remnants of a human presence that vanished long before these modern lanes were paved.
